Share via


SnapshotIsolationState Enumeration

The SnapshotIsolationState enumeration contains values that are used to specify the current state of snapshot isolation.

네임스페이스: Microsoft.SqlServer.Management.Smo
어셈블리: Microsoft.SqlServer.SqlEnum (in microsoft.sqlserver.sqlenum.dll)

구문

‘선언
Public Enumeration SnapshotIsolationState
public enum SnapshotIsolationState
public enum class SnapshotIsolationState
public enum SnapshotIsolationState
public enum SnapshotIsolationState

Members

Member name Description
Disabled Snapshot isolation is not currently in effect.
Enabled Snapshot isolation is in effect. If the transaction isolation level is set to snapshot then the versions of updates to a record are stored in the tempdb database.
PendingOff Snapshot isolation is waiting to be disabled when all current transactions commit or roll back.
PendingOn Snapshot isolation is waiting to be enabled when all current transactions commit or roll back.

주의

The SnapshotIsolationState enumeration class is served by the SnapshotIsolationState property.

This namespace, class, or member is supported only in version 2.0 of the Microsoft .NET Framework.

플랫폼

개발 플랫폼

지원되는 플랫폼 목록은 SQL Server 2005 설치를 위한 하드웨어 및 소프트웨어 요구 사항을 참조하십시오.

대상 플랫폼

지원되는 플랫폼 목록은 SQL Server 2005 설치를 위한 하드웨어 및 소프트웨어 요구 사항을 참조하십시오.

참고 항목

참조

Microsoft.SqlServer.Management.Smo Namespace